The 2022 AP Human Geography exam will be split equally between two sections: multiple-choice and free-response questions. Each section is worth 50 percent of the exam score. You will have 1 hour to answer 60 multiple-choice questions and 1 hour, 15 minutes to answer 3 free-response questions. Going into test day, this is the exam format to expect: 60 multiple-choice questions with 1 hour to complete them. About 30-40% of these questions will have a stimulus attached (data, image, map, etc.). 3 free-response questions with 1 hour and 15 minutes to complete them. Question 1 will have text only.

More than 1 million Mexicans are employed at over 3,000 maquiladoras. North American Industry fears in the U.S. and Canada. Labor leaders fear that more manufacturers relocate production to Mexico to take advantage of lower wage rates. Labor intensive industries such as food processing and textile manufacturing are especially attracted to ...
